Blueman vs BlueSoleil: The Verdict

⚡ Summary:

Blueman: Blueman is an open source Bluetooth manager and adapter GUI for Linux desktop environments. It allows you to easily manage Bluetooth devices and connections, such as headsets, audio devices, keyboards and more from a unified interface.

BlueSoleil: BlueSoleil is Bluetooth software for Windows that enables Bluetooth connections between devices. It allows users to transfer files, stream audio, and sync data seamlessly over Bluetooth.

Key Features Comparison

Blueman
Blueman Features
  • Manage Bluetooth devices/connections
  • Pair/connect Bluetooth devices
  • Send files to devices
  • Set up Bluetooth tethering
  • Supports multiple adapters
  • GTK interface
  • App indicator support
  • Command line interface
  • Plugin support
BlueSoleil
BlueSoleil Features
  • Bluetooth connectivity
  • File transfer
  • Audio streaming
  • Data syncing
  • Remote device control
